    Can You Prevent Cow's Milk Protein Allergy?

    19/1/2026 | 16 mins.
    Is your baby’s fussiness more than “just reflux”? Christine explains the signs of cow’s milk protein allergy, the role of the infant gut and immune system, and why early recognition and support can make a big difference.

    What Does Food Sensitivity Have To Do With Picky Eating?

    12/1/2026 | 12 mins.
    What if your child’s picky eating isn’t behavioral at all? In this episode, Christine breaks down how food sensitivities and gut inflammation can quietly interfere with appetite and food acceptance—and why addressing these hidden factors can accelerate progress for picky eaters.

    Is your child constantly moving, zoning out, or melting down — and you’re wondering if it’s ADHD… or something else? In this episode, Christine looks beyond the label and explores the hidden factors that can make kids look “ADHD” on the outside: mouth breathing, poor sleep, gut inflammation, ultra-processed foods, lack of movement, and nervous system overload. You’ll learn what the research actually says about dyes and diet, why movement and structure act like medicine for the brain, how to support dopamine and norepinephrine naturally, and what to consider if you do choose medication — including how to protect your child’s gut.     Why Won’t My Child Gain Weight? The Real Reasons (It’s Not Just About Calories)

    10/11/2025 | 20 mins.
    Your child eats… but the scale barely moves. You’re counting bites, tracking calories, maybe even adding butter and shakes — and still, nothing changes. In this episode, Christine breaks down the real reasons kids struggle to gain weight — and why it’s rarely about calories alone. From missing hunger cues to food sensitivities, gut inflammation, thyroid and iron issues, and sensory challenges, she walks you through what to test, what to look for, and how to bring appetite back naturally. Is your child a picky eater? Maybe they are fussy about trying new foods or actually have a fear of trying new foods. In this podcast, we learn tips and strategies on how to get your picky eaters enjoying mealtimes by shifting mindset, working with their sensory system, improving their oral motor skills, remediating gut issues and more. Your host is a mom and a pediatric feeding therapist with extensive training in oral motor, speech, sensory feeding, mindset, and nutrition.
